Subject: Verdant controller cut-over complete

The cut-over of the Hollyvane greenhouse controller to the new drift-correction firmware finished at 03:40 local. Temperature and humidity sensors recalibrated cleanly; two CO2 probes needed a manual offset, now logged. Watch for drift alarms over the next 48 hours — thresholds are tighter than before. The active configuration after cut-over is as follows.

deployment values, fadug-bawif:
SORWYN_LOG_LEVEL=debug
SORWYN_METRICS_HOST=metrics.sorwyn.qirvansys.internal
SORWYN_POOL_SIZE=32

## Deployment

The Shelfwright catalogue importer ships as a single container and runs nightly against the Marlowe Public Library feed. Before promoting to production, verify the staging import completes without MARC parse warnings and that duplicate detection stays under two percent. For the weekly sync, note that the service reads the following configuration values at startup.

settings of tagef-bawif:
DRUIX_HOST=druix.zemvarlabs.internal
DRUIX_PORT=8000

### Relevance Tuning Notes — Findlewick Search

Welcome! Our ranking tweaks live in the `tuning-notes` repo — every boost, decay, and synonym change gets a short writeup there. Before touching weights, replay last week's queries through the offline evaluator so we can compare click metrics. The evaluator talks to the internal judgments store, authenticated with the key below.

API key for yahig-tadup: kto7_ubizbYm